A restaurant company and its owner have won their court battle against a Tennessee law requiring businesses to post "warning" signs outside their bathrooms if they let transgender people use them, convincing a federal judge that the statute violates their First Amendment rights by compelling speech.

A Tennessee federal judge has preliminarily blocked a state law requiring businesses to post "warning" signs outside their bathrooms if they let transgender people use them, handing a win to the American Civil Liberties Union in its challenge to the law's constitutionality.

The American Civil Liberties Union challenged the constitutionality of a new Tennessee law in a federal lawsuit Friday, saying the state can't require businesses to post "warning" signs outside their bathrooms if they let transgender people use them.
